Subject: Error on installing FreeBSD 4.4 on Dell Inspiron 2650 ( 2.0 GHz
)


Hi
I bought a laptop ( Dell Inspiron 2650 ) and want to install 4.4BSD on
it . 
but when it is going to be installed after it ask for configuration when
the 
kernel is going to probe the devices and write the devices on the screen
, 
it says that
pci0 <unknown device> (vendor=8086 .... ) IRQ ...
pci0 <unknown device> (vendor=8086 .... ) IRQ ...
pci0 <unknown device> (vendor=8086 .... ) IRQ ...
and then it hanged up and never going to continue

What can i do ???????????
